    With the help of the new music app

    Listen offline

    You can download songs, including songs that you purchased from the iTunes Store, adding music from Apple, or have been matched or downloaded with Apple music or iTunes game - to your device to listen to when you're not connected to the Internet:

    1. Tap the Options icon plus next to the item.
    2. Press the download icon to the right of the work of the song at the top of the menu of Options, or tap more to download from the bottom of the menu.
    3. The song is downloaded on your device.

    To display the music you downloaded for offline listening, go to my music. In the section recently added, press the category picker (artist, album, etc.). Only downloaded music is at the bottom of the list of categories. When this setting is enabled, My Music shows only the songs you downloaded on your device. Disable this setting to see all of your music, including the music stored in iCloud music library.

    When you view an item that you have downloaded on your device, you will see an icon offline near it but its exact location varies. For example:

    • If you download a whole album or playlist, offline icon appears when you look at the album or playlist in my music. You will also see an icon in offline mode when you view a compilation, but not when you view specific genres, composers or artists.
    • If you download a song, the offline icon to the right of each title of the song.
    • If you download songs from the album, but not whole album, offline icon appears to the right of the just the songs you downloaded.

    Try to restart the application first:

    Restart the application

    Most of the problems solve if you leave the Apple music, then re-open it.

    To ensure that the application is completely closed and all background processes are stopped until you reopen it, follow these steps:

    1. In the home screen, tap applications.
    2. Press settings.
    3. Scroll down to Applications and press 'Application Manager'.
    4. Press Apple's music.
    5. Press Stop Force. If you see a message that says "If you force stop an application, it can lead to errors," press OK.
    6. Return to the home screen or in your applications list, then reopen the Apple music.
